1.42 – The Long Wait for a Court Date: Waiting for your court date can feel endless. You might worry about what will happen or what others will think. The time between being charged and appearing in court can bring anxiety, guilt, and fear. But this waiting period is also a test of responsibility. Staying out of trouble shows you’re serious about changing. Judges notice when people stay clean, go to school, or follow rules while waiting. It proves you’re trying to turn things around before punishment even begins. Use this time to reflect and improve, not stress and panic. Staying focused and patient can help lead to a better outcome. The wait may feel long, but it’s also a chance to show who you really are becoming.
